Low Poly Games on iOS in Malta: Q3 2024 Performance
Discover the performance trends of the top low poly games on iOS in Malta during Q3 2024, with insights on downloads and revenue shifts.
In the third quarter of 2024, the low poly games category on iOS in Malta showcased intriguing dynamics, with varying trends across downloads and revenue. This analysis, based on data from Sensor Tower, provides a closer look at the performance of the top five games.
Roblox, published by Roblox Corporation, demonstrated a consistent increase in revenue, peaking at roughly $2.6K in early September. The game's weekly downloads experienced a noticeable rise in August, reaching a high of approximately 280K, before tapering off towards the end of the quarter.
Frozen City from Century Games Pte. Ltd. saw a notable increase in both downloads and revenue. Weekly revenue climbed steadily, culminating at around $92 in mid-September. Downloads mirrored this upward trend, peaking at 74K in the first week of September.
Eatventure, by Lessmore UG, displayed a mixed performance. The app's revenue fluctuated, with a significant peak of $61 in early September. Downloads, however, showed a declining pattern, dropping to a low of 1K by late September.
AppQuantum Publishing Ltd's Idle Lumber Empire - Wood Game experienced an upward trend in revenue, reaching a peak of $227 by mid-September. The download numbers varied, with a notable increase to 37K at the end of the quarter, marking a recovery from a mid-quarter dip.
Finally, Idle Theme Park - Tycoon Game, developed by Digital Things, had a fluctuating revenue pattern, with a peak of $49 in late July and a resurgence to $40 in mid-September. Downloads saw a late-quarter rise, reaching approximately 40K by the end of September.
